"The Mountain Is You" by Brianna Wiest is a thought-provoking book that offers valuable insights into personal growth, healing, and transformation. This book is a must-read for anyone seeking to overcome their personal struggles and live a more fulfilling life.
In the book, Brianna Wiest uses the metaphor of a mountain to describe the challenges that we face in our lives. She explains how our struggles and pain are like mountains that we must climb, and how the journey to the top is often difficult and treacherous. However, just as climbing a mountain can be a transformative experience, so too can overcoming our personal challenges.
One of the key themes of the book is the idea that we must take responsibility for our own lives. Brianna Wiest argues that we cannot control everything that happens to us, but we can control how we respond to those events. She encourages readers to take ownership of their thoughts, emotions, and actions, and to use their experiences as opportunities for growth and self-discovery.
The book also emphasizes the importance of self-compassion and self-love. Brianna Wiest argues that we cannot truly love and care for others unless we first love and care for ourselves. She encourages readers to practice self-compassion and to be kind to themselves, even in the face of their mistakes and failures.
Throughout the book, Brianna Wiest offers practical tips and exercises to help readers apply these concepts to their own lives. She provides tools for managing negative self-talk, practicing self-care, and cultivating gratitude and joy. She also includes personal anecdotes and stories from others who have overcome their own mountains, making the book relatable and inspiring.
